Stellantis India announces price hike for Citroen and Jeep models

Stellantis India, a leading automotive conglomerate, has declared a price hike of 0.5% across all Citroen models and for the Compass and Meridian variants under the Jeep brand, effective April 30, 2024.

This price hike will translate to an incremental rise ranging from Rs 4,000 to Rs 17,000 across the respective models.

The decision to revise prices is driven by the upward trajectory of input costs and operational expenditures. With this adjustment, Stellantis aims to navigate the current economic landscape while ensuring the continued delivery of innovative vehicles to its esteemed clientele, the company shared.
